History
Baldur is one of the gods that meets to try to work out a way to stop the Apocalypse. Along with Kali, he appears to be one of the most powerful of the gods present. It is also implied that he is in some sort of relationship with Kali. Baldur is killed by Lucifer after trying to stop him.
Characteristics
Baldur appeared as a young man with black hair and dressed in a formal suit.

Appearances
5.19 Hammer of the Gods
Baldur, along with Kali, hosts a meeting with other gods at the Elysian Fields Hotel about the upcoming Apocalypse. When Lucifer arrives, he tries to attack him but is killed after Lucifer punches him through the chest.
Baldur in Lore
Baldur (also Balder, Baldr) is a god in Norse mythology associated with light, beauty, love, innocence, forgiveness and happiness.
